Golang Go语言中哪个web管理系统框架最好

发布于 1周前 作者 zlyuanteng 来自 Go语言

Golang Go语言中哪个web管理系统框架最好

Web Management System 又名 后台管理系统, Admin templates 。主要用来数据可视化,管理数据,又被叫中后台系统。

GitHub 上有 4 个超过 1000 star 的 golang 相关项目。技术栈基本雷同,想问问大家对他们的评价。

GitHub 搜索 golang admin:

你没有看错,前两个的组织和仓库名几乎一致。


更多关于Golang Go语言中哪个web管理系统框架最好的实战系列教程也可以访问 https://www.itying.com/category-94-b0.html

1 回复

更多关于Golang Go语言中哪个web管理系统框架最好的实战系列教程也可以访问 https://www.itying.com/category-94-b0.html


在Golang(Go语言)中,关于哪个Web管理系统框架最好,这实际上取决于您的具体需求和项目背景。以下是一些流行的Go语言Web框架,它们在不同场景下都有其独特的优势:

  1. Gin:以其高性能和易用性著称,特别适合构建需要高吞吐量和低延迟的Web应用和微服务。Gin的路由性能极佳,支持中间件,并内置了许多实用工具,让开发者可以快速上手。
  2. Beego:一个功能全面的Go语言Web框架,提供了MVC架构支持,并包括ORM、缓存、配置管理、日志等实用模块。它适合构建大型、复杂的Web应用程序。
  3. Echo:一个高性能、简洁易用的Go语言Web框架,特别适合构建RESTful API。Echo支持中间件机制,并提供了灵活的路由机制。
  4. Revel:一个全栈的Web框架,提供了丰富的功能和工具,如路由、ORM、模板渲染等,无需配置即可运行。

选择框架时,请考虑项目的需求、性能要求、开发人员的经验以及社区支持等因素。每个框架都有其优点和适用场景,没有绝对的“最好”之选。建议详细了解每个框架的特点和优势,然后结合您的实际需求进行选择。

回到顶部